How to open your fashion showroom from scratch - step by step

The first step is to register the activity. It is divided into several stages:

  • documents are collected - this is a TIN, an identity card with its copies, an application is written for registration and taxation, a state duty is paid;
  • OKVED code is selected;
  • an application for the opening of activities is being prepared for the tax authorities.

The second step is the technical part. Consists of the following steps:

  1. We are looking for a convenient location for the studio, which is going to be opened.
  2. All equipment is purchased.
  3. Suppliers are selected.
  4. Studio employees are selected (if necessary).
  5. Advertising is being carried out.

Where to buy products

Since the showroom is a business that is associated with the purchase of things, you must first start looking for suppliers.

Today, there are several options for purchasing goods at wholesale and retail prices.

The first option is online shopping. Usually, such stores sell most often Chinese things, on which you can make a 100% rise. If there is no exact idea of ​​the quality of goods in different stores, then you will have to make several purchases from different suppliers in order to understand which store is better to give preference to.

Note. Chinese things can have different quality. Today, many Russian stores sell quality goods from China, which are distinguished by an acceptable cost. However, it is important to remember that wealthy clients are unlikely to visit such a clothing showroom.

The second option is American sites. Many American discount sites offer items from popular brands. Of course, the models will be last year's, but the brand, quality, and price will attract a solid buyer.

The third option is outlets. This concept implies retail outlets where last year's goods are sold, discounted by 70%. The purchase of such goods must be carried out independently, deliberately, selecting the desired products.

The fifth option is factories for tailoring things. Garment factories carry out tailoring according to catalogs, but they can also work on requests, which can be sent remotely. Their products are of good quality, but most importantly - affordable wholesale prices. The only negative is that the manufacturer sets its own minimum cash wholesale, which allows you to purchase goods.

What does a business plan for opening a showroom look like?

An approximate cost calculation that everyone who wants to open their own showroom for clothes will face consists of several points:

  • to legalize trade, 5 thousand rubles will be required, of which the state duty will be 800 rubles;
  • the initial purchase is approximately 100 thousand;
  • renting a room for one month is about 40 thousand rubles (by the way, this is an important point that is often forgotten);
  • repair work (if needed) will amount to 100 thousand, this amount may be less, its size will depend on the condition of the leased area;
  • the purchase of furniture is about 50 thousand rubles.

In the case when the purchase of goods will take place independently, the costs must include the cost of the road, as well as hotel accommodation - this is 50 thousand rubles.

Thus, in order to launch your studio, you need initial capital. This is about 400 thousand rubles.

What is hidden in this word?

Let's start our acquaintance with the term we are interested in with its etymology. If you turn to the help of dictionaries in English, it will be possible to find out that the showroom is a transcription of the foreign phrase show room. The latter in translation means "demonstration or exhibition hall". We can say that the showroom is a place where any goods are exhibited in front of the audience. As a rule, this is done for informational purposes. The visitor can get more detailed information about the products he is interested in, as well as place an order for the supply or manufacture of a sample he likes. Yes, this is true: in showrooms, for the most part, only single copies of goods are exhibited, designed to attract customers. Here, products are never presented in mass quantities. Currently, showrooms of clothes, shoes, cars, furniture, tiles, laminate, sanitary ware, etc. are most widely used.

Principles of work of the showroom - abroad and in Russia

In Europe, showrooms are divided into three types:

  • closed, working from large and famous brands;
  • open ateliers-salons from small manufacturers;
  • private indoor showrooms that sell designer items at retail.

Wholesale buyers of large consignments of goods have access to the establishments of the first type for their further resale.

Everyone has access to open atelier-salons, for example, a showroom for fur coats, shoes, wedding dresses, where tailoring is carried out by order of the client.

Small private showrooms can be accessed by appointment or by invitation. They sell clothes and shoes from both eminent and not so famous designers. It is from such small showrooms that young designers begin their careers, for whom it is not easy to break into the world of big fashion.

Fashion houses in showrooms do not sell copies of collections, but only present them for detailed consideration. This is done mainly for large buyers.

In Russia, the first showrooms appeared in the early 2000s and they were organized in private apartments. There, domestic fashionistas demonstrated branded items brought from abroad at affordable prices. One of the goals of such a hall is to sell things without crazy markups, due to which the rent of the premises and the salary of the staff should pay off. For those entrepreneurs who were rapidly growing, there were more spacious and modern studios for displaying and selling fashionable clothes.

We can say that the Russian showroom is a closed club for its own. It is difficult for a “man from the street” to break into such a place. It is necessary to have acquaintances among visitors or know the necessary phone numbers. The first Moscow showrooms were interest societies attended by celebrities, fashion designers, and the capital's elite.

Automobiles, household appliances, building materials

It is a mistake to think that a showroom is only a platform for demonstrating fashionable clothes, shoes and furniture. There are showrooms in which new models of cars are exhibited, household appliances and samples building materials. That is, the filling of the showroom can be very different.

Showroom goals:

  • introduce consumers to new products (for example, cars or appliances);
  • win a place in the market;
  • increase demand for products/services;
  • introduce new types of services.

In some cases, a showroom is an opportunity to quickly and profitably sell used goods. Famous car companies arrange them to sell used cars.

The home appliances showroom gives customers the opportunity to see how a refrigerator, oven and microwave oven will look in the interior of the kitchen, to check their functionality.
